## Deploying the Gatewick Proctor Queue

Deploys are pretty painless: push to main, wait for the pipeline, then watch the queue drain dashboard for five minutes. If candidates pile up mid-exam, roll back first and ask questions later — the queue replays safely. Everything the workers care about lives in one config block, shown here for reference.

settings of bafof-yagef:
JOROX_PIN=8740
JOROX_TENANT=pelox
JOROX_METRICS_HOST=metrics.jorox.qorvelworks.internal
JOROX_SEAL=seal_c78f63c1
JOROX_STANDBY_TEAM=norax

TURN-208: Gatevale turnstile counters at the Merrow Field pilot double-count when a rotation reverses mid-cycle. Attendance totals drift roughly 2% high per event. The debounce window fix is implemented, reviewed by Ilsa, and soak-tested across two simulated match days without drift. Ready for your cut; the candidate build is identified below.

trace token, tagag-tafog: htk6_5ed18c

## Changelog — Ticktrace 1.9

### Renamed: DRIFT_API_TOKEN
During the cron drift investigation we found plugins confusing this variable with the metrics token, so it has been renamed to indicate it authorizes drift-report uploads specifically. Plugin authors must read the new name from 1.9 onward; the old name is ignored without warning. Sample env files in the SDK are updated. In your deployment env file, the drift-report upload secret is set on the next line.

env line for fawef-taguf: VAULT_KEY13=a9695905a9a90

## Formula sandbox tuning

User-supplied formulas in Gridmoor execute inside a restricted interpreter with hard ceilings on time, memory, and call depth. Reviewers should confirm any change to these ceilings is justified in the PR description, since raising them widens the abuse surface. Defaults were chosen from production traces. The current limits are as follows.

limits module of tafog-fawip:
WEIGHTS = {
    "julix": 57,
    "lamys": 992,
    "kasvan": 209,
    "quenok": 750,
    "alddor": 259,
    "oliath": 1009,
    "wenix": 815,
}